Ibrahim Tanko, the coach of Medeama SC, has expressed optimism regarding the strong competition within his squad as they gear up for their Week 20 match against Karela United. With impressive form, having secured four wins and one draw in their last five games, Medeama is looking to extend their unbeaten streak. Tanko noted that the consistent performances of his players have created a selection headache, but he sees this as a positive development that enhances team dynamics. The match is scheduled to kick off at 3:00 PM on Sunday at the TnA Stadium. In contrast, Karela United, currently positioned eighth in the league standings, is eager to bounce back from two losses in their last three outings and improve their performance on the pitch.
